Medical Drug Detox

A San Diego medical detox program is the initial step for somebody who is beginning treatment for a severe addiction to substances like heroin, alcohol or benzodiazepines. In drug or alcohol detox, patients are supervised by trained health professionals who can monitor symptoms and ensure that patients stay safe while withdrawing from drugs or alcohol.

In a medical detox treatment program, staff can offer medications to reduce the pain of withdrawal as drugs and alcohol are leaving the body. For instance, experts report that people who are withdrawing from heroin might take lofexidine to alleviate withdrawal signs. People might also take buprenorphine or methadone during medical detox. It is very important to keep in mind that medication is only utilized throughout withdrawal when clinically cleared by a medical professional.

MAT

Medications can be used throughout the withdrawal process in medical detox, and they can also belong of an ongoing medication-assisted treatment program. Medication-assisted treatment involves using medications in tandem with counseling during the recovery process.

Medication-assisted treatment is normally utilized to treat dependencies to illicit opioids, prescription opioids and alcohol. Medications can help manage yearnings and support both brain chemistry and physical performance. According to research study, medication-assisted treatment can assist people stay in treatment, lower opiate abuse, boost survival rates and reduce criminal activity. Similar to with medical detox, methadone treatment and buprenorphine are typically prescribed in medication-assisted treatments for opioid addiction. Disulfiram and acamprosate might be utilized for the treatment of alcohol abuse.

Inpatient Treatment for San Diego Residents

San Diego Inpatient drug rehab is usually supplied in a medical facility or a center that concentrates on inpatient treatment. In this kind of treatment setting, medical professionals supervise patients and have 24-hour access to nurses. People taking part in inpatient treatment frequently receive medications and counseling services and participate in group therapy.

Inpatient treatment usually involves ongoing evaluation of the addiction and monitoring of goals. As soon as a patient has finished inpatient treatment, staff create a discharge plan and the patient is transferred to another treatment setting, such as ongoing outpatient therapy.

San Diego California Residential Rehab

Residential rehab resembles inpatient treatment however is usually longer-lasting. According to the National Institute on Substance Abuse (NIDA), residential services generally occur outside of a health center setting, implying residential centers provide more of a home-like environment. People getting residential care reside at the treatment facility on a full-time basis.

Remains in residential rehab can last for a couple of weeks or a number of months, with the goal of helping people establish healthy social skills and change ineffectual habits. However, the length of treatment is thorough and can vary commonly depending upon both the program and the individual’s needs.

Partial Hospitalization Program

A partial hospitalization program provides an alternative to inpatient or residential treatment. According to The Association for Ambulatory Behavioral Healthcare, these programs are provided either in healthcare facilities or freestanding centers and offer intensive services. People who participate in a partial hospitalization program might get treatment during days, evenings, or weekends, and they return house in the evening. If a helpful house environment isn’t available, clients may live in a sober living facility.

Partial hospitalization works for patients who are not a danger to themselves however still require intensive treatment. In these programs, people spend more time in treatment than those in standard outpatient programs, however they might be able to live in the house and get treatment through the Nobu teletherapy app.

Intensive Outpatient Programs

Intensive outpatient treatment involves group treatment sessions as well as specific therapy. People who are engaged in intensive outpatient treatment may likewise take medications and get medication management services. Depending on the program, customers may live off-site in the house or in sober living housing. Online counseling is likewise common for this level of care.

Intensive outpatient programs are an alternative to hospitalization or inpatient programs. In some cases, people will begin an intensive outpatient program after transitioning out of an inpatient setting. According to research, intensive outpatient programs provide at least nine hours of service each week, however some programs might be more intensive.

Outpatient Rehab

Outpatient rehab is a step down from intensive outpatient treatment. Per the American Society of Addiction Medicine, somebody in outpatient treatment receives less than 9 hours of services weekly.

Comparable to intensive outpatient programs, outpatient rehab normally includes specific and group counseling in addition to access to medication and medical services. In outpatient programs, people arrange appointments at times that fit their schedules, and they can continue to work in the community and live at home throughout treatment. Outpatient programs provide versatility, which is a benefit of this kind of treatment.

Dual Diagnosis Treatment

Dual diagnosis treatment is offered to people who have both an addiction and a mental health condition. For instance, an individual who copes with opioid addiction and bipolar illness would be a prospect for dual diagnosis treatment.

With this type of treatment, people receive incorporated services that resolve both addiction and mental health conditions. People in dual diagnosis services get therapy, supportive services and medications. Treatment strategies need to consider both the mental health condition and the addiction to be effective. For instance, if a person gets treatment for addiction, however underlying depression is not treated, the person might regression to substance abuse as a kind of self-medication.

Court-Ordered Treatment

Court-ordered treatment is provided as a legal consequence for drug-related offenses, and includes consequences for noncompliance. Research studies reveal that court-ordered treatment is simply as effective, if not more so than voluntary addiction treatment. may take numerous forms and typically is performed in the very same setting as voluntary treatment. The particular requirements of treatment differ with each distinct court sentence. In some cases, treatment might be provided as an option to incarceration or as a method to lower the length of imprisonment or probation.

Depending on the level of offense, kinds of court-ordered treatment consist of educations programs, group counseling, outpatient programs, community-based programs and residential programs.

Christian Treatment

Some treatment facilities approach addiction recovery through the lens of spirituality. The most widely known neighborhood support group, Twelve step programs (AA), was established on strong spiritual concepts and continues to promote faith-based recovery to its 2 million members around the globe.

If you believe that spiritual concepts could benefit your recovery, you can easily discover treatment programs that carry out these principles alongside conventional medicine. Research shows that recovering patients with greater levels of spirituality display positive qualities such as increased optimism, lower stress and anxiety and greater resilience to tension. By assisting an individual in recovery find self-confidence, faith-based rehab centers wish to strengthen their course to sobriety.

San Diego Aftercare Centers

Aftercare consists of services that people participate in to keep long lasting sobriety after finishing a treatment program. Aftercare services might include ongoing therapy, participation in support system, or linkage to case management or peer assistance services. Aftercare plays an important function in avoiding relapse. According to research study, aftercare is more effective when people take part in it for longer time periods.

Short-Term vs Long-Term Addiction Treatment in San Diego

Short-term treatment generally lasts around thirty days, however treatment of this length may not always be effective. NIDA reports that short-term residential programs are typically intensive, and it is essential for people to shift into an outpatient program after completing one.

Long-term treatment typically lasts somewhere between 3 and 12 months. Long-term residential treatment takes place in a home-like setting, and people have access to medical care 24 hours a day. A common model for long-term treatment is the healing neighborhood, and people in this type of program typically stay in treatment for 6 to 12 months. Long-term treatment usually begins with detox from drugs, and after that an individual shifts into the program, which is at first rigorous and follows a structured schedule with rigid guidelines. As people make development in treatment, they are granted more versatility.

The Typical Addiction Treatment Process in San Diego CA

Addiction treatment is a process that typically takes place in stages. For instance, the treatment process for addiction typically begins with a consumption appointment and continues from there.

The following are typical steps in an addiction treatment program:

  • Intake: The intake process involves an addiction expert event info to confess you into a treatment program. For example, the professional will discuss your health history and likely carry out a standard medical checkup. Standard information, such as date of birth, income, family background and employment history will also be gathered during the consumption process.
  • Screening & Evaluation: During the screening and evaluation stage of treatment, a specialist will use a tool such as the Substance Abuse Evaluating Test (DAST) to determine the extent of a person’s issues with substance abuse. These tools involve a quick interview and efficiently offer the treatment team with info about an individual’s substance use. Using screening and evaluation results, the expert team can identify what further evaluations are needed.
  • Evaluation: After the screening and evaluation are completed, a complete drug abuse evaluation will be finished. This assessment will be more extensive. During this assessment, a clinician will collect info about your history of substance abuse, consisting of when you first began using, what substances you have actually used and how often and in what quantities you have actually utilized. The clinician will also discuss symptoms of your substance abuse, such as whether or not you experience withdrawal, what physical repercussions you have experienced as a result of drug abuse and whether you have experienced legal difficulties or difficulties at work or home due to drugs. A clinician might use an evaluation tool such as the Addiction Seriousness Index (ASI) to gather thorough details about your substance usage and its repercussions.
  • Developing a Treatment Plan: After a full assessment is finished, a clinician will deal with you to develop a treatment plan. Addiction treatment plans address areas of requirement, such as avoiding drugs and acquiring employment, as well as what services or resources will be utilized to address these areas. A treatment strategy likewise states long-term goals and shorter-term goals. Professionals report that treatment strategies ought to likewise utilize a client’s strengths.
